The 2006 Pumpkinmania Giant Pumpkin Weigh-off & Contest Results!

Good afternoon, Growers!

Yesterday, a foggy morning greeted the giant pumpkin faithful for the 2006 Pumpkinmania Giant Pumpkin Weigh-off and Contest. With congratulations and encouragement in the form of a letter from The Governor of California, the Honorable Arnold Schwarzenegger in hand, the sponsors, staff, and management waited in the mist for this year’s entries to arrive at the Centennial Heritage Museum. After an initial rush of entries between 8:30 a.m. and 9:00 a.m., a slight lull set in, and we wondered if the unusually hot weather of July had taken its toll upon the Southern California giant pumpkin growing community like it had upon so many other growers.

Fortunately, any anxiety was quickly eliminated when a parade of giants began to fill the colorful sponsor banner-laden staging area just in front of the blacksmith shop. The exclamations of disbelief and delight were deafening. The deafening sounds of gunfire, however, were the Western reenactment group “Satin and Spurs”. Attendees were also entertained and educated by gourd crafts, a gourd witch, food booths, face-painting, The Balloon Diva, The Victorian Tea Society, the Scout pumpkin sale, and the University of California Cooperative Extension Master Gardeners table.

By 11:30 a.m., nineteen, yes nineteen valiant and courageous competitors’ entries were arranged, ready for the Final Weigh-Off. Before the Final Weigh-Off, the winners of Best Color, Funniest Shape, Ugliest, Youngest Grower, and Most Experienced Grower were announced after the judges, Ty Hall of Kellogg Garden Products, Brian Smith of Crainco Crane Company, Phil Concan of Roadkyll Graphics and Screenprinting, and Kenji Otsuka of HB-101 Organic Plant Growth Enhancer, completed their thoughtful and extremely fair deliberations.

The Final Weigh-Off began at 12:00 noon, and the 250 spectators that had gathered were amused and amazed by the new giant pumpkin sling moving and weighing technology.

Unfortunately, there was an “equipment malfunction” and for the first time in Pumpkinmania’s six-year history, we lost one. The entry, ‘Charlie’ was finally weighed at 71 pounds. ‘Charlie’ was grown by Judy Hales, of Huntington Beach. The sponsors, staff and management of Pumpkinmania apologize for your loss, Judy, and we hope you will participate again. This usually doesn’t happen. Really, it doesn’t. Plus, it didn’t help when this history-making incident was captured by the local Time Warner Cable television crew.

Because of the efficient and now experienced weighing technology, weighing the remaining eighteen entries was finished in less than 45 minutes. There was a tense moment near the end of the Final Weigh-Off when Eva Bassett’s entry ‘Little Man’ at 639 pounds, began to leak profusely when lifted. This indicated a fissure going deep into the pumpkin’s cavity, and ‘Little Man’ was disqualified. The shock and disbelief on Eva’s face was palpable. Then again, the rules are the rules.

I’m proud, and extremely pleased to announce the winners of the 2006 Pumpkinmania Giant Pumpkin Weigh-off & Contest!

First Place: Glenn Basset of Simi Valley, 826 pounds, ‘Big Man’, $1,000 from Kellogg Garden Products/Gardner & Bloome, and a hand-crafted gourd trophy

Second Place: Michelle Lofthouse of Monrovia, 635 pounds, ‘Dimple’, $500 from Kellogg Garden Products/Gardner & Bloome, and a hand-crafted gourd trophy

Third Place: John Gerdes of Midway City, 523.5 pounds, ‘Water’, $300 from Kellogg Garden Products/Gardner & Bloome, and a hand-crafted gourd trophy

Fourth Place: Mark Imhoof of Irvine, 417.5 pounds, ‘Fasta’, $50 Gift Certificate from Batavia Garden Nursery in Orange

Fifth Place: McKenna Mars of Anaheim Hills, 285 pounds, ‘Fat Mac’, $50 Gift Certificate from Batavia Garden Nursery in Orange

The top five finishers also received 100 cc bottles of HB-101 and 18 ounce bottles of Neptune’s Harvest Fish and Seaweed Blend fertilizer.

Masters and Institutional Division

First Place: Stuart Shim of Huntington Beach, 406 pounds, ‘Carla’, for The Honor and The Glory
